Today, we’re going to be talking about Baggage; I’m going to give you three tips that will ensure that your bag gets to your destination with your every time.

So, the first tip is:

1. Make sure you get to the airport ontime

When the airlines tell you what time to get to the airport, there’s a reason for that.  As they need all the time to get you checked in and get your baggage with you to your destination.  So get to the airport ontime is the first one.

The second one is when you are checking in make sure that the agent checking you in checks your bag to the correct destination.

Let’s say for example you are going from Okinawa to Tokyo say to Los Angeles; make sure your bags says LAX, not NRT or not HND.  HND is the other airport in Tokyo and NRT is the international airport although Haneda is also an international airport now.

But, just make sure your bags says the final destination you are going to and make sure that agent ask you and ust say hey you checked it to Los Angeles right? And they’ll say yes, put LAX on it and you’re good to go.

So that’s #2.

The third on is that when you make your reservation, look at the connection time, make sure you have enough time to make your connection.  As sometimes if your connection is too quick your bags may not make it and you make it.  Or if your flight is delayed your bag may not make it and you make it.

Now, typically, when your bag does not make it on that flight, it makes it on the next schedule flight the airline has or if they don’t have one for a little while they’ll find another method of getting it to you.

Usually they will deliver it to wherever you’re staying, so make sure your name is on the inside and also the outside of your bag. This way if the tag gets lost they can still figure out whose bag is it.

And the phone number you should have is the destination phone number or your mobile so they can always get in touch with you.

So there are three tips that can help you:

  1. Get to the airport ontime
  2. Make suer your bags are checked to the correct destination and
  3. Don’t have such a short connection time in case of delays
